gender为空

来源:4-2 用户服务搭建(下)

weixin_慕仰1047700

2020-05-08

{
	"telephone":"343",
	"password":"353",
	"nickName":"Sam",
	"gender":
}

报错

{
    "status": "fail",
    "data": {
        "errCode": 10004,
        "errMsg": "Unknown Error"
    }
}

而不是报 gender不能为空的错,BusinessException没有被catch到,这是为什么呢?

写回答

1回答

龙虾三少

2020-05-08

debug下代码

0
1
weixin_慕仰1047700
org.springframework.http.converter.HttpMessageNotReadableException: JSON parse error: Unexpected character ('}' (code 125)): debug之后发现错误了,如果gender为空的话,应该写成 { "telephone":"343", "password":"353", "nickName":"Sam" } 不然gender的值就默认为后面的"}"
2020-05-08
共1条回复

ES7+Spark 构建高匹配度搜索服务+千人千面推荐系统

ElasticSearch实现高相关性搜索,Spark MLlib实现个性化推荐

1386 学习 · 559 问题

查看课程